Deokjin Kim dc06df31b6 readline: refactor to use validateNumber
`validateNumber` throws more proper error code and
error name.

// Handle a write from the tty
[kTtyWrite](s, key) {
const previousKey = this[kPreviousKey];
key = key || kEmptyObject;
this[kPreviousKey] = key;
if (!key.meta || key.name !== 'y') {
// Reset yanking state unless we are doing yank pop.
this[kYanking] = false;
}
// Activate or deactivate substring search.
if (
(key.name === 'up' || key.name === 'down') &&
!key.ctrl &&
!key.meta &&
!key.shift
) {
if (this[kSubstringSearch] === null) {
this[kSubstringSearch] = StringPrototypeSlice(
this.line,
0,
this.cursor
);
}
} else if (this[kSubstringSearch] !== null) {
this[kSubstringSearch] = null;
// Reset the index in case there's no match.
if (this.history.length === this.historyIndex) {
this.historyIndex = -1;
}
}
// Undo & Redo
if (typeof key.sequence === 'string') {
switch (StringPrototypeCodePointAt(key.sequence, 0)) {
case 0x1f:
this[kUndo]();
return;
case 0x1e:
this[kRedo]();
return;
default:
break;
}
}
// Ignore escape key, fixes
// https://github.com/nodejs/node-v0.x-archive/issues/2876.
if (key.name === 'escape') return;
if (key.ctrl && key.shift) {
/* Control and shift pressed */
switch (key.name) {
// TODO(BridgeAR): The transmitted escape sequence is `\b` and that is
// identical to <ctrl>-h. It should have a unique escape sequence.
case 'backspace':
this[kDeleteLineLeft]();
break;
case 'delete':
this[kDeleteLineRight]();
break;
}
} else if (key.ctrl) {
/* Control key pressed */
switch (key.name) {
case 'c':
if (this.listenerCount('SIGINT') > 0) {
this.emit('SIGINT');
} else {
// This readline instance is finished
this.close();
}
break;
case 'h': // delete left
this[kDeleteLeft]();
break;
case 'd': // delete right or EOF
if (this.cursor === 0 && this.line.length === 0) {
// This readline instance is finished
this.close();
} else if (this.cursor < this.line.length) {
this[kDeleteRight]();
}
break;
case 'u': // Delete from current to start of line
this[kDeleteLineLeft]();
break;
case 'k': // Delete from current to end of line
this[kDeleteLineRight]();
break;
case 'a': // Go to the start of the line
this[kMoveCursor](-Infinity);
break;
case 'e': // Go to the end of the line
this[kMoveCursor](+Infinity);
break;
case 'b': // back one character
this[kMoveCursor](-charLengthLeft(this.line, this.cursor));
break;
case 'f': // Forward one character
this[kMoveCursor](+charLengthAt(this.line, this.cursor));
break;
case 'l': // Clear the whole screen
cursorTo(this.output, 0, 0);
clearScreenDown(this.output);
this[kRefreshLine]();
break;
case 'n': // next history item
this[kHistoryNext]();
break;
case 'p': // Previous history item
this[kHistoryPrev]();
break;
case 'y': // Yank killed string
this[kYank]();
break;
case 'z':
if (process.platform === 'win32') break;
if (this.listenerCount('SIGTSTP') > 0) {
this.emit('SIGTSTP');
} else {
process.once('SIGCONT', () => {
// Don't raise events if stream has already been abandoned.
if (!this.paused) {
// Stream must be paused and resumed after SIGCONT to catch
// SIGINT, SIGTSTP, and EOF.
this.pause();
this.emit('SIGCONT');
}
// Explicitly re-enable "raw mode" and move the cursor to
// the correct position.
// See https://github.com/joyent/node/issues/3295.
this[kSetRawMode](true);
this[kRefreshLine]();
});
this[kSetRawMode](false);
process.kill(process.pid, 'SIGTSTP');
}
break;
case 'w': // Delete backwards to a word boundary
// TODO(BridgeAR): The transmitted escape sequence is `\b` and that is
// identical to <ctrl>-h. It should have a unique escape sequence.
// Falls through
case 'backspace':
this[kDeleteWordLeft]();
break;
case 'delete': // Delete forward to a word boundary
this[kDeleteWordRight]();
break;
case 'left':
this[kWordLeft]();
break;
case 'right':
this[kWordRight]();
break;
}
} else if (key.meta) {
/* Meta key pressed */
switch (key.name) {
case 'b': // backward word
this[kWordLeft]();
break;
case 'f': // forward word
this[kWordRight]();
break;
case 'd': // delete forward word
case 'delete':
this[kDeleteWordRight]();
break;
case 'backspace': // Delete backwards to a word boundary
this[kDeleteWordLeft]();
break;
case 'y': // Doing yank pop
this[kYankPop]();
break;
}
} else {
/* No modifier keys used */
// \r bookkeeping is only relevant if a \n comes right after.
if (this[kSawReturnAt] && key.name !== 'enter') this[kSawReturnAt] = 0;
switch (key.name) {
case 'return': // Carriage return, i.e. \r
this[kSawReturnAt] = DateNow();
this[kLine]();
break;
case 'enter':
// When key interval > crlfDelay
if (
this[kSawReturnAt] === 0 ||
DateNow() - this[kSawReturnAt] > this.crlfDelay
) {
this[kLine]();
}
this[kSawReturnAt] = 0;
break;
case 'backspace':
this[kDeleteLeft]();
break;
case 'delete':
this[kDeleteRight]();
break;
case 'left':
// Obtain the code point to the left
this[kMoveCursor](-charLengthLeft(this.line, this.cursor));
break;
case 'right':
this[kMoveCursor](+charLengthAt(this.line, this.cursor));
break;
case 'home':
this[kMoveCursor](-Infinity);
break;
case 'end':
this[kMoveCursor](+Infinity);
break;
case 'up':
this[kHistoryPrev]();
break;
case 'down':
this[kHistoryNext]();
break;
case 'tab':
// If tab completion enabled, do that...
if (
typeof this.completer === 'function' &&
this.isCompletionEnabled
) {
const lastKeypressWasTab =
previousKey && previousKey.name === 'tab';
this[kTabComplete](lastKeypressWasTab);
break;
}
// falls through
default:
if (typeof s === 'string' && s) {
let nextMatch = RegExpPrototypeExec(lineEnding, s);
if (nextMatch !== null) {
this[kInsertString](StringPrototypeSlice(s, 0, nextMatch.index));
let { lastIndex } = lineEnding;
while ((nextMatch = RegExpPrototypeExec(lineEnding, s)) !== null) {
this[kLine]();
this[kInsertString](StringPrototypeSlice(s, lastIndex, nextMatch.index));
({ lastIndex } = lineEnding);
}
if (lastIndex === s.length) this[kLine]();
} else {
this[kInsertString](s);
}
}
}
}
}
